Good To Know
- The morning tour lasts 5 hours, covering Marble Mountains, Monkey Mountain, and the Lady Buddha statue.
- Explore the stunning limestone formations and caves at Marble Mountains, including the mystical Am Phu Cave.
- Visit Monkey Mountain to see the 67-meter Lady Buddha statue and enjoy panoramic views of the Son Tra Peninsula.
- The tour includes a delightful Vietnamese lunch featuring traditional dishes like pho and banh mi.
- Convenient hotel pickup and drop-off are provided, ensuring a comfortable and accessible experience for travelers.

Highlights of Monkey Mountain
Nestled within the breathtaking landscapes of Da Nang, Monkey Mountain boasts stunning views and rich cultural significance that captivate all who visit.
This majestic site features the towering statue of Lady Buddha, standing at an impressive 67 meters, offering a serene presence amidst the lush greenery.
As visitors explore the area, they’re rewarded with panoramic vistas of the Son Tra Peninsula and the tranquil bay below.
The tranquil atmosphere and rich biodiversity make it a perfect spot for nature lovers and photographers alike.
Monkeys frolic in the trees, adding to the charm of the mountain.
With its blend of natural beauty and spiritual heritage, Monkey Mountain serves as a must-see destination for anyone traveling in Da Nang.
Exploring Marble Mountains
While exploring Marble Mountains, visitors encounter a breathtaking fusion of natural beauty and cultural heritage. Towering limestone formations rise majestically from the earth, housing intricate caves and tunnels that whisper stories of ancient legends. Among the most captivating sites is Am Phu Cave, a mystical place that invites curiosity and reflection. Visitors often marvel at the craftsmanship of local stone sculptures, witnessing artisans at work in nearby factories.
Feature | Description | Duration |
---|---|---|
Cave Exploration | Navigate through caves and tunnels | 1 hour |
Local Artisans | Visit stone sculpture factories | 30 minutes |
Am Phu Cave | Experience the longest and mysterious cave | 30 minutes |
This rich tapestry of experiences makes Marble Mountains a must-visit destination.

Inclusions of the Tour
The tour to Marble Mountains, Monkey Mountain, and Lady Buddha offers a comprehensive package that ensures a memorable experience for every traveler.
It includes convenient hotel pickup and drop-off, making the journey hassle-free. Travelers will enjoy the comfort of an air-conditioned vehicle, and entrance fees for both Marble Mountains and Am Phu Cave are covered.
An English-speaking guide enriches the experience with insightful commentary. A delightful local lunch is provided, along with a refreshing bottle of water to keep everyone hydrated.
Plus, the tour includes insurance for peace of mind and tips for both the guide and driver, ensuring that every aspect of the trip is catered to, allowing travelers to fully enjoy the breathtaking surroundings.
